Lot 49

Matched pair of silver Art Nouveau candlesticks.

Description

Condition Report

A matched pair of silver Art Nouveau candlesticks, each with cylindrical stem embossed with flowers and leaves and with conforming decoration to the spreading square base (filled), with detachable nozzle. Hallmarked William Comyns & Sons Ltd., London 1903 and 1906, also with registration number 415205. Height measures 6 1/4 inches (16cm).

    Both candlesticks display wear commensurate with the age and use. Both have surface marks and scratches and also various dints in the metal. The embossed flower and leaf decoration is generally okay on both but there is some loss of detail to the decoration around the base of the stem. The candlestick dated 1906 does have some quite large dints to the cylindrical stem and the seam line is just about visible. The detachable sconce is a little misshapen around the rim and there are some contact marks. There are various other small nicks and dints, especially around the base, and a larger dent to one of the corners. The candlestick dated 1903 is in similar condition, although there are not as many dints to the stem. Again the seam line is just about visible. There are various nicks and dints around the base and also a possible repair to one side. The hallmarks and part hallmarks on both are a little rubbed but still clear and legible.
